Brief Summary

The primary study objective is to assess the rates of blood stream infection (BSI) from the use of Three-Chamber Bags (e.g., SmofKabiven®, Kabiven®, others) compared to Hospital Compounded Bags (HCBs)...

Detailed Description

This is a retrospective observational database study of patients receiving parenteral nutrition (PN) for at least 3 consecutive days with hospital admission date between January 1, 2013, and December ...

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Adult hospital inpatients ≥ 18 years
  • Treatment with PN for at least 3 consecutive days
  • PN containing all three major macronutrients, delivered from 3CB or HCB
  • Patients with hospital admission between January 1, 2013, and December 31, 2015 (study period)

Exclusion

  • Bloodstream infection before or at the same day of first PN administration
  • Immunosuppression due to concomitant therapy (e.g., immunosuppressive therapy due to transplantation, concomitant oral or intravenous administration of glucocorticoids) or disease (e.g., HIV, leukaemia)
  • Permanent vascular access (port, shunts for dialysis)
  • Femoral venous placement of central venous line used for PN
  • Burns, extensive skin injuries (e.g., Lyell´s disease)
  • Chemo-/radiotherapy for up to 3 months before hospital admission
  • Change of PN bag type during observation period, e.g., from HCBs to 3CBs or vice-versa
